摘要
参照生物制品质量要求,连续制备3批脑膜炎球菌多糖-精破类偶联抗原,其多糖含量为19.8~24.4%(w/w),该种拟糖蛋白具有波长为245nm特征性的紫外光吸收谱,在Sepharose-CL 4B柱层析上Kd为0。偶联抗原中多糖的抗原性在火箭电泳上虽与单纯多糖相似,但其免疫原性则明显增强。偶联抗原在4℃存放3年或在37℃存放8周,其免疫原性无明显改变。加温处理过的偶联抗原经Sepharose-CL4B和SDSPAGE检查表明,多糖与蛋白共价结合是相当稳定的。
According to quality requirement of biologics, we prepared three successive lots of Meningococcal Group A Polysaccharide-Tetanus Toxcid Conjugate Vaccine, which was composed of 19.8-24.4% (w/w) Polysaccharide moiety. The neoglycoprotein had a characteristic ultraviolet spectrum of 245nm and Kd value of 0 on Sepharose-CL4B.The immunogenicity of Ps moiety of the conjugate was markedly enhanced although the antigenicity of Ps moiety was the same as plain polysaccharide on the rocket immunoelectrophoresis.The stability of the conjugates was examined. There was no significant difference in immunogenicity of the conjugates during 3-year storage at 4℃ or 8-week storage at 37℃. The tests using gel permeation chromatography with Sepharose-CL4B and SDS-PAGE strongly affirmed the covalency of the derivatized protein-polysaccharide linkage and its stability through high temperature treatment.
